Leading agency

Holiday Shoppe Operations are delighted to announce the opening of Ohakune Holiday

Shoppe, effective Saturdav 14 December, said franc

manager Campbell McMahon. "Holiday Shoppe is New Zealand's leading travel agency brand with an 80-strong group of franchised travel retailers throughout New Zealand. Each of the businesses are locally owned and oper-

ated," said Mr McMahon. Holiday Shoppe is a subsidi-

ary of Gullivers Pacific Group Limited, New Zealand's largest independent

wholesale and retail travel group. "Holiday Shoppe is where every holiday is a special experience. Where the
